Chemical Properties | Powder | Uses | Malic dehydrogenase has been used in a study to assess a flow injection system for on-line monitoring of fumaric acid in biological processes. It has also been used in a study to investigate a root-knot nematode parasitizing peanut in Texas. | Uses | Malic dehydrogenase has been used in a study to assess the comparative molluscicidal action of Ginko biloba extract on snail hosts. It has also been used in a study to investigate the effect of early feed restriction on metabolic programming and compensatory growth in broiler chickens. | General Description | Cytoplasmic Isozyme | Biochem/physiol Actions | Malic Dehydrogenase (MDH) plays an important role in the citric acid cycle in mitochondria. It catalyzes the interconversion of substrates malate and oxaloacetate with the simultaneous oxidation/reduction of NAD/NADH+. MDH present in the cytosol is involved in the shuttling of malate/aspartate. |
